7 способов загрузки кода Visual Studio с примерами кода

Visual Studio Code (VS Code) — популярный редактор исходного кода, разработанный Microsoft. Он обеспечивает легкую и универсальную среду для разработки программного обеспечения. В этой статье блога мы рассмотрим семь различных способов загрузки кода Visual Studio, а также примеры кода. Независимо от того, новичок вы или опытный разработчик, эти методы помогут вам быстро и эффективно начать работу с VS Code.

Метод 1: Официальный сайт
Самый простой способ загрузить Visual Studio Code — посетить официальный сайт ( https://code.visualstudio.com/ ). Оттуда вы можете перейти на страницу загрузок и выбрать версию, соответствующую вашей операционной системе. Вот пример использования Python для автоматизации процесса загрузки:

import urllib.request
url = 'https://go.microsoft.com/fwlink/?LinkID=760868'
file_name = 'vscode.exe'
urllib.request.urlretrieve(url, file_name)
print('Download complete.')

Метод 2: менеджеры пакетов
Если вы используете менеджер пакетов, например Homebrew (для macOS) или Chocolatey (для Windows), вы можете установить VS Code с помощью простой команды. Вот пример использования Homebrew:

brew install --cask visual-studio-code

Метод 3: Дистрибутивы Linux
Для пользователей Linux код Visual Studio доступен в репозиториях пакетов большинства популярных дистрибутивов. Вот пример установки его в Ubuntu с помощью apt:

sudo apt update
sudo apt install code

Метод 4. Инсайдеры кода Visual Studio
Инсайдеры кода Visual Studio — это отдельная версия, обеспечивающая ранний доступ к предстоящим функциям и улучшениям. Чтобы загрузить программы предварительной оценки кода Visual Studio, посетите официальный веб-сайт программы предварительной оценки ( https://code.visualstudio.com/insiders ) и выполните те же действия, что и в методе 1.

Метод 5: портативная версия
Если вы предпочитаете портативную версию Visual Studio Code, не требующую установки, вы можете загрузить ZIP-пакет с официального сайта. После загрузки извлеките содержимое в нужную папку и запустите исполняемый файл «кода». Вот пример использования PowerShell для автоматизации процесса извлечения:

$url = 'https://update.code.visualstudio.com/1.63.2/win32-archive/stable'
$zipFile = 'vscode.zip'
$extractPath = 'C:\VSCode'
Invoke-WebRequest -Uri $url -OutFile $zipFile
Expand-Archive -Path $zipFile -DestinationPath $extractPath

Метод 6: удаленный код Visual Studio
Visual Studio Code Remote позволяет разрабатывать код в удаленной среде, например в контейнере, виртуальной машине или удаленном компьютере. Чтобы загрузить расширение Visual Studio Code Remote, откройте VS Code и перейдите к представлению «Расширения», найдите «Remote — SSH» или «Remote — Containers» и нажмите кнопку установки.

Метод 7. Готовый контейнер Docker
Если вы работаете с Docker, вы можете загрузить готовый образ контейнера кода Visual Studio из Docker Hub. Вот пример использования команды docker runдля запуска VS Code внутри контейнера:

docker run -it -p 127.0.0.1:8080:8080 -v "$PWD:/home/coder/project" codercom/code-server

В этой статье мы рассмотрели семь различных способов загрузки Visual Studio Code: от официального веб-сайта до менеджеров пакетов, портативных версий и удаленных сред. Эти методы обеспечивают гибкость и удобство, удовлетворяя потребности разработчиков с различными предпочтениями и требованиями. Следуя предоставленным примерам кода, вы сможете легко настроить Visual Studio Code и начать свой путь программирования.